T. L. Gilbert is a scholar working on Atomic and Molecular Physics, and Optics, Electronic, Optical and Magnetic Materials and Materials Chemistry. According to data from OpenAlex, T. L. Gilbert has authored 37 papers receiving a total of 4.4k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Atomic and Molecular Physics, and Optics, 7 papers in Electronic, Optical and Magnetic Materials and 7 papers in Materials Chemistry. Recurrent topics in T. L. Gilbert's work include Advanced Chemical Physics Studies (15 papers), Iterative Methods for Nonlinear Equations (4 papers) and Atomic and Molecular Physics (4 papers). T. L. Gilbert is often cited by papers focused on Advanced Chemical Physics Studies (15 papers), Iterative Methods for Nonlinear Equations (4 papers) and Atomic and Molecular Physics (4 papers). T. L. Gilbert collaborates with scholars based in United States, United Kingdom and Australia. T. L. Gilbert's co-authors include Arnold C. Wahl, P. S. Bagus, T. P. Das, A. Norman Jette, Clemens Roothaan, O. C. Simpson, Mark A. Williamson, R. Benedek, Nora H. Sabelli and P. J. Bertoncini and has published in prestigious journals such as The Journal of Chemical Physics, Reviews of Modern Physics and Chemical Physics Letters.
